好的,我將圍繞軟件研發(fā)質量績效考核表,為你撰寫一篇結構清晰、內容豐富的專業(yè)文章。文章的主要內容如下:
接下來,我將開始撰寫這篇關于軟件研發(fā)質量績效考核表的正文部分。
軟件研發(fā)質量績效考核表:驅動卓越代碼與團隊效能的科學引擎
在數(shù)字化轉型浪潮席卷全球的今天,軟件研發(fā)質量已成為企業(yè)核心競爭力的關鍵要素。一套科學嚴謹?shù)?strong>軟件研發(fā)質量績效考核體系不僅關乎技術團隊的工作評價,更是連接代碼質量與商業(yè)價值的戰(zhàn)略紐帶。通過量化指標將抽象的質量概念轉化為可衡量、可改進的具體維度,這種考核機制為研發(fā)團隊提供了清晰的改進方向,同時為企業(yè)管理層提供了客觀的決策依據(jù)?,F(xiàn)代軟件研發(fā)績效考核已從簡單的代碼行數(shù)統(tǒng)計,演進為融合工程效能、質量屬性、過程規(guī)范和業(yè)務價值的多維評價體系,其設計理念直接影響著技術創(chuàng)新的速度和產品在市場中的成敗。
構建多維考核體系:從代碼行數(shù)到價值創(chuàng)造
現(xiàn)代軟件研發(fā)質量績效考核體系的核心在于其多維度指標設計和分層分類原則。與傳統(tǒng)單一產出量考核不同,科學的質量考核表需覆蓋軟件研發(fā)的全生命周期,針對不同職級的工程師設置差異化的指標權重。例如,初級工程師可能更側重代碼產出和過程規(guī)范性,而高級工程師則需考察架構設計能力和技術影響力。某2025年績效考核表顯示:初級工程師代碼工時占比達60%,而高級工程師的方案設計量占比提升至30%,體現(xiàn)了職責差異帶來的考核側重點變化。
考核指標設計需遵循SMART原則(具體、可衡量、可達成、相關、有時限),并涵蓋三大核心領域:
表:典型軟件研發(fā)質量績效考核指標權重分布
| 考核維度 | 初級工程師 | 中級工程師 | 高級工程師 |
|--|-|-|-|
| 代碼產出 | 60% | 50% | 30% |
| 方案設計 | 0% | 10% | 30% |
| 過程規(guī)范 | 20% | 30% | 30% |
| 組織貢獻 | 10% | 10% | 10% |
質量成本量化分析:平衡短期效率與長期質量
在質量管理經(jīng)濟學視角下,績效考核需反映質量成本(Cost of Quality, CoQ)的優(yōu)化成果。質量成本模型將投入分為三類:預防成本(如代碼評審、培訓)、評價成本(如自動化測試)和失效成本(如生產故障修復)。研究表明,在需求分析階段投入1元預防成本,相當于測試階段10元的修復成本,更遠優(yōu)于上線后100元的故障處理成本。卓越的績效考核表應引導團隊增加預防性投入,降低高代價的后期修復。
質量量化模型需要解決指標片面性問題。僅關注缺陷數(shù)量可能導致測試人員陷入“無效提單”陷阱——模塊A的測試人員提交50個問題單(30個有效),反而不如模塊B的18個高價值問題單貢獻大,因為后者提升了缺陷定位效率。科學的考核應引入缺陷有效性、嚴重等級加權等機制,例如某企業(yè)將缺陷分為四級(Urgent/High/Medium/Low),分別賦予1.0、0.7、0.3、0.1的權重系數(shù),綜合計算質量得分。
自動化度量工具鏈的整合大幅提升了考核客觀性?,F(xiàn)代研發(fā)效能平臺(如思碼逸)通過代碼分析引擎自動采集代碼當量、提交頻率、注釋覆蓋率等指標;結合Jira的累積流圖(Cumulative Flow Diagram)可視化工作流瓶頸;通過控制圖(Control Chart)識別周期時間異常。工具鏈的閉環(huán)使考核數(shù)據(jù)實時性提升60%,人工采集成本下降75%。工具依賴也帶來新挑戰(zhàn)——無法量化架構設計的前瞻性、代碼可維護性等長期價值,需通過技術評審等主觀評價補充。
敏捷指標融合實踐:適應迭代開發(fā)的新范式
敏捷開發(fā)的普及要求績效考核體系兼容迭代動態(tài)性。Scrum團隊需將沖刺燃盡圖(Sprint Burndown)、速率(Velocity)、流動效率(Flow Efficiency)等敏捷指標納入評估框架。燃盡圖反映團隊承諾的完成度,理想狀態(tài)應呈平穩(wěn)下降曲線;若曲線陡降或停滯,往往預示任務分解粒度不當或范圍蔓延。速率指標則用于衡量團隊可持續(xù)產出能力,但需避免跨團隊比較——團隊A的50故事點與團隊B的75故事點因估算基準不同,并不代表生產力差異。
敏捷指標的核心價值在于促進持續(xù)改進而非績效考核本身。VersionOne的調研顯示,濫用速度指標(如將其與獎金強掛鉤)的團隊,故事點虛高現(xiàn)象增加23%,技術債務占比上升18%。高效能團隊更關注周期時間(Cycle Time)的優(yōu)化:通過控制圖分析,將代碼提交到生產的平均時間從72小時縮短至8小時,部署頻率提升近9倍。這印證了《Accelerate》的結論:軟件交付效能與企業(yè)市場績效存在顯著正相關。
DevOps指標的整合進一步豐富了考核維度。平均故障修復時間(MTTR)反映故障響應能力,平均故障間隔(MTBF)體現(xiàn)系統(tǒng)穩(wěn)定性。結合故障扣分機制(如A級故障扣10分),形成質量紅線約束。某互聯(lián)網(wǎng)企業(yè)的考核表規(guī)定:生產環(huán)境P1級故障直接取消年度評優(yōu)資格,推動開發(fā)人員建立“質量左移”意識,單元測試覆蓋率從58%提升至85%。
表:敏捷開發(fā)團隊核心考核指標參考值
| 指標類型 | 健康閾值 | 改進目標 | 度量方法 |
|--|--|--|--|
| 部署頻率 | >1次/天 | >3次/天 | 單位時間部署次數(shù) |
| 變更前置時間 | <8小時 | <1小時 | 代碼提交到生產耗時 |
| 變更失敗率 | <15% | <5% | 導致故障的發(fā)布占比 |
| 平均恢復時間 | <1小時 | <30分鐘 | 故障修復時長(MTTR) |
績效反饋與團隊賦能:從評估到成長的范式轉變
績效考核的*目標不是劃分等級,而是構建持續(xù)改進閉環(huán)。高效的反饋機制包含三個層次:實時儀表盤(如個人代碼質量熱力圖)、迭代回顧會(分析速度波動原因)、季度績效面談(制定改進計劃)。思碼逸平臺的實踐表明,將代碼問題密度與組織平均值對比可視化,可使改進方向明確度提升40%。這種透明化反饋使工程師清楚“質量差距在哪”及“如何改進”,而非被動接受排名。
激勵與發(fā)展并重的考核設計激發(fā)技術創(chuàng)新活力。華為“代碼工匠”計劃示范了良好實踐:將組織貢獻量化為考核項,開發(fā)者提交的工具若被團隊復用,按使用次數(shù)獲得加分;技術分享文檔被收錄知識庫,按閱讀量計算創(chuàng)新分。反向激勵機制同樣重要——某車企對注釋率低于20%的代碼按比例扣減當量,推動代碼可維護性提升。這種平衡約束與創(chuàng)新的機制,使團隊技術債務占比下降34%。
質量文化的塑造需要管理層承諾與工具支持。技術主管需在考核中示范質量優(yōu)先行為——如谷歌工程總監(jiān)每周審查關鍵代碼評審響應時間,將其納入管理者考核。工具層面,Jira的質量門禁(Quality Gate)將代碼覆蓋率、靜態(tài)檢查結果與流水線聯(lián)動,質量不達標則阻塞上線。這種“質量即速度”的理念重塑,使團隊從被動合規(guī)轉向主動追求卓越。
挑戰(zhàn)與優(yōu)化方向:面向未來的考核體系演進
當前考核體系仍面臨指標片面性與工具依賴性的雙重挑戰(zhàn)。一方面,過度依賴量化指標可能導致戰(zhàn)略性工作被忽視,如某團隊因追求代碼當量而減少重構投入,三個月后缺陷率上升70%。自動化工具無法評估代碼設計合理性等深層質量,MIT的研究指出,僅37%的架構設計缺陷能被靜態(tài)分析捕獲。混合評估模型(Hybrid Evaluation Model)成為新趨勢:70%量化指標+30%同行評審,結合架構師打分平衡短期產出與長期質量。
數(shù)據(jù)驅動的持續(xù)優(yōu)化機制是體系健壯性的關鍵。建議每季度進行指標有效性驗證:
1. 相關性分析:檢查代碼復雜度與生產故障率的相關系數(shù)
2. 權重調整:根據(jù)業(yè)務階段動態(tài)調整權重(如新產品期提升效率權重,成熟期強化穩(wěn)定性)
3. 負面清單:識別易被操縱的指標(如代碼行數(shù)),設置上限閾值
國際標準組織正推動ISO/IEC 25000系列標準的落地,其提出的質量模型將安全性、隱私性納入核心指標,為考核體系提供前瞻框架。而AI輔助評估(如自動代碼可維護性預測)的應用,將進一步提升評估效率——初步實驗顯示,GPT-4在架構合理性評估中與專家評審一致性達81%。
構建質量與效能并重的評價新生態(tài)
軟件研發(fā)質量績效考核體系的核心價值,在于將抽象的質量原則轉化為可行動的改進指南。通過多維指標設計(代碼質量、流程規(guī)范、技術創(chuàng)新)、質量成本優(yōu)化(預防>修復)、敏捷指標融合(燃盡圖、周期時間)和持續(xù)反饋機制(可視化報告、質量門禁),它成為驅動工程卓越的核心引擎。成功的考核體系不僅需要科學指標和工具支持,更需要建立質量優(yōu)先的組織文化——技術主管在評審中示范質量決策,工程師將注釋覆蓋率提升視為榮譽而非負擔,團隊共同追求代碼當量與設計美學的平衡。
未來的考核體系將向三化演進:智能化(AI輔助評估)、動態(tài)化(按業(yè)務階段調整權重)和價值化(連接代碼質量與商業(yè)成果)。微軟Azure團隊的實踐已指明方向——將服務級別目標(SLO)達成率與工程師考核關聯(lián),使可用性從99.5%提升至99.95%,客戶留存率增長13%。這種將代碼質量映射到客戶價值的閉環(huán),標志著軟件研發(fā)績效考核從“管理工具”到“戰(zhàn)略資產”的本質蛻變。當我們不再僅詢問“代碼是否無缺陷”,而是探索“代碼如何創(chuàng)造業(yè)務韌性”,軟件質量才真正成為數(shù)字化時代的核心競爭力。
> “你不能衡量的東西,你也無法改進?!薄?·*的這句管理學箴言,恰揭示了軟件研發(fā)質量績效考核的本質意義:它是一面*的鏡子,既映射出代碼當下的健康狀態(tài),更照亮了通往工程卓越的道路。當考核體系植根于質量文化,它便超越了評估工具的角色,成為驅動技術團隊持續(xù)創(chuàng)新的永動機。
轉載:http://www.caprane.cn/zixun_detail/445575.html